The second leg of the 2025/26 Champions League third qualifying round between Crvena Zvezda (Serbia) and Lech (Poland) will take place on August 12 at the Rajko Mitic Stadium in Belgrade. The first leg ended 3-1 in favor of Crvena Zvezda. Crvena Zvezda vs. Lech: prediction and betting odds, statistics.
Crvena Zvezda
Vladan Milojević's side secured a 3-1 away victory in the first match. As a result, Crvena Zvezda achieved their fourth consecutive win in the Champions League. Moreover, the club extended their scoring streak in this European competition to nine matches. However, in 9 of the last 11 Champions League games, the team failed to keep a clean sheet. Now, to progress to the next round, the Serbians need to avoid losing by more than one goal in regular time. Notably, Crvena Zvezda participated in the main stage of the Champions League in the last two seasons.
- The team has not won in regular time in 7 of their last 10 home Champions League matches (2 draws, 5 losses).
- The club's players scored exactly 1 or 2 goals in 8 of their last 10 home games in this European competition.
- The Serbians conceded at least two goals in regular time in 7 of their last 10 home Champions League matches.

Lech
In the first match, the club lost at home, marking their second defeat in the last eight European competition matches (with 6 wins in the remaining games). Furthermore, Lech failed to keep a clean sheet for the eighth time in nine previous European matches. Meanwhile, the team extended their scoring streak in European club tournaments to 12 matches. To advance to the next round, the Polish side must win by at least three goals in 90 minutes. If the club wins by a two-goal margin, extra time will be played. It is worth noting that Lech has never advanced beyond the third qualifying round in the Champions League.
- The team has not lost in regular time in 7 of their last 8 away European matches (4 wins, 3 draws).
- At least three goals were scored in 90 minutes in 4 of the club's last 5 away European matches.
- The Polish side scored in regular time in 9 of their last 10 away matches in European club tournaments.
